      <description>&lt;P&gt;I used the IRS website to pay what I owe on April 15.&amp;nbsp; I used Turbotax on line to do my taxes.&amp;nbsp; I am concerned that I may have scheduled two payments to IRS instead of one.&amp;nbsp; In past years when I used Turbotax to do my taxes, the payment to IRS was automatically included in the process of doing the taxes, step by step, on line.&amp;nbsp; Is there a way to find out if I have scheduled two payments instead of one.&amp;nbsp; The IRS has accepted by 2024 return.&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;TO CANCEL A TAX PAYMENT YOU SCHEDULED&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;If your return was accepted, you cannot change your payment method&lt;SPAN class="Apple-converted-space"&gt;&amp;nbsp; &lt;/SPAN&gt;or payment date.&lt;SPAN class="Apple-converted-space"&gt;&amp;nbsp; &lt;/SPAN&gt;The only thing you can do is cancel the payment and then pay by a different method on your own.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;UL&gt;
&lt;LI&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;Call IRS e-file Payment Services&amp;nbsp;24/7 at 1-888-353-4537 to ask about or cancel your payment, but please wait 7 to 10&amp;nbsp;days after your return was accepted before calling.&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;
&lt;LI&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;Cancellation requests must be received no later than 11:59 p.m. ET two business days prior to the scheduled payment date.&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;

      <description>&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size:14px;"&gt;In addition to calling the IRS as &lt;SPAN style="background: var(--ck-color-mention-background); color: var(--ck-color-mention-text);"&gt;&lt;a href="https://ttlc.intuit.com/community/user/viewprofilepage/user-id/67938"&gt;@xmasbaby0&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/SPAN&gt; suggested, you can check your records of the payment you made online to the IRS, and check your TurboTax return to determine whether you also designated a payment there.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size:14px;"&gt;For TurboTax Online: To&amp;nbsp;&lt;STRONG&gt;print your tax return worksheets and schedules after you file&lt;/STRONG&gt;, please follow these instructions:&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;OL&gt;
 &lt;LI&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size:14px;"&gt;Log into your TurboTax account&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;
 &lt;LI&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size:14px;"&gt;Scroll to the bottom of page, click&amp;nbsp;&lt;STRONG&gt;Add a State&lt;/STRONG&gt;( you are not adding a state, this is just to get in the right menu)&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;
 &lt;LI&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size:14px;"&gt;Over to the left, click&amp;nbsp;&lt;STRONG&gt;Tax Tools&amp;nbsp;&lt;/STRONG&gt;dropdown&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;
 &lt;LI&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size:14px;"&gt;Click the&amp;nbsp;&lt;STRONG&gt;Print Center&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;
 &lt;LI&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size:14px;"&gt;Click the&amp;nbsp;&lt;STRONG&gt;Print, save or preview this year's return&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;
 &lt;LI&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size:14px;"&gt;Check&lt;STRONG&gt;&amp;nbsp;Federal returns and/or State returns&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;
 &lt;LI&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size:14px;"&gt;Select&lt;STRONG&gt;&amp;nbsp;Include government and TurboTax worksheets (optional)&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;
 &lt;LI&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size:14px;"&gt;Then,click&amp;nbsp;&lt;STRONG&gt;View or print forms&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;
&lt;/OL&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size:14px;"&gt;See &l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;A href="https://ttlc.intuit.com/turbotax-support/en-us/help-article/print-file/print-copy-tax-return-turbotax/L3SIJv7YS_US_en_US?uid=ltaip5xa" target="_blank"&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size:14px;"&gt;this help article&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/A&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size:14px;"&gt; for more information.&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size:14px;"&gt;In the desktop versions for TurboTax, you can click on Forms mode and look at the forms and worksheets if you didn't print them out.&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size:14px;"&gt;You can visit&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;A href="https://www.irs.gov/payments/online-account-for-individuals" target="_blank"&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size:14px;"&gt; this IRS webpage &l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/A&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size:14px;"&gt;for details on how to set up an individual IRS Online Account where you can a&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;SPAN style="color:rgb(27,27,27);font-size:14px;"&gt;ccess your individual account information including balance, payments, tax records and more.&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
